Is Athens or Aarhus cheaper?
Athens is generally cheaper. COL+Rent: Athens 38.8 vs Aarhus 45.1 (NYC=100).
What is $3,000/mo in Athens worth in Aarhus?
$3,000/mo of purchasing power in Athens equals ~$3,487/mo in Aarhus using COL adjustment.
